Fantasy General II - Invasion is the reimagination of the strategy game classic from the 90s!
Armies once again draw battle-lines on the war-torn land of Keldonia, and a new generation of commanders will test their bravery and tactics against each other. Fantasy wargaming is back!
There I was, driving my panzers deep into the Western Desert in Panzer Corps 2 when I had an idle thought, "Gee, I wonder how Fantasy General 2 compares if I were to really dedicate myself to it?" I had dabbled with it after release.
After taking it slow and starting on the lowest difficulty I have progressed up and am now back at The Gap at a higher difficulty and nothing will stop me from playing.
My respect and admiration for this game grow as I trudge on. I am a veteran wargamer and this is the best experience I have had where all the mechanics really mean something. Everything matters: the march up, the deployment, reserves, who attacks and who defends, where and when, terrain, timing, cohesion and morale, experience, ranged, melee and standoff weapons It is the whole enchilada.
